Wanted: Dead is a single-player action-adventure game that blends hack-and-slash melee combat with third-person shooter mechanics in a cyberpunk setting. Players take control of Lt. Hannah Stone, a cyborg operative in the Zombie Unit, an elite Hong Kong police squad tasked with exposing a large-scale corporate conspiracy over the course of one week. The experience emphasizes fluid weapon switching between a sword and various firearms while navigating linear levels filled with mercenaries, synthetics, and private security forces.
Gameplay
The core loop centers on close-quarters sword attacks combined with ranged gunplay. Players execute combos that flow between slashing strikes and pistol shots, with opportunities to perform over 50 unique finishing moves on staggered enemies. A skill tree allows upgrades across offense, defense, and utility categories to expand move options and improve survivability. Weapons include assault rifles, SMGs, LMGs, and grenade launchers, encouraging players to adapt loadouts mid-encounter. The game includes checkpoint-based progression where death returns the player to the last save point within the current section.
Additional activities break up the action through minigames such as a rhythm sequence, karaoke sessions, a crane game, and a side-scrolling shooter titled Space Runaway featuring seven levels. These elements provide brief diversions without altering the main combat focus. The title recommends controller input for precise timing on combos and movement. Environmental interaction plays a role, as players can use surroundings to gain advantages against groups of foes in the dystopian Hong Kong streets and facilities.
Game Modes
The primary mode is the single-player campaign that follows the Zombie Unit's investigation through a series of story-driven missions. After completing the main story, New Game Plus unlocks Japanese Hard mode, which requires starting a fresh save file and features increased difficulty with no chapter selection available. Progress from the initial playthrough carries over in most areas, allowing players to test refined skills against tougher enemy placements and behaviors.
No separate multiplayer or cooperative modes exist. The structure remains linear with a focus on sequential level completion rather than open exploration or repeatable side objectives beyond the minigames encountered during the campaign.
Story and Setting
The narrative unfolds in a retro-futuristic version of Hong Kong where high-tech weaponry meets 1990s-inspired aesthetics. Hannah Stone, released from a life sentence to join the squad, works alongside her team to dismantle the conspiracy. Cutscenes advance the plot, some presented in anime style, while dialogue and character interactions reveal the unit's dynamics and the broader corporate intrigue. The week-long timeframe keeps the scope contained to key operations and revelations.
Is It Worth Playing?
Wanted: Dead suits players who enjoy demanding combat that rewards practice with sword-and-gun combos and precise timing. The skill tree and finishers add depth for those willing to experiment with upgrades across multiple runs. Japanese Hard mode extends the challenge for completionists after the initial campaign. A 2024 anniversary patch addressed various combat statistics and stability issues, improving the overall experience for those returning or starting fresh. Reception has been mixed, with praise directed at the hybrid combat system and criticism aimed at voice acting and narrative delivery. Those seeking a focused single-player action title with old-school beat 'em up influences in a modern package will find the most value here, particularly if they prefer controller-based gameplay over keyboard and mouse. The game remains available on PC without additional seasonal content or live-service elements.
